Agreement on Energy Saving

Last updated: 5 November 2017
Since legislation for energy savings-related matters falls under the responsibility of both the Federal Provinces and the federal government, an agreement between the federal government and the Federal Provinces, in accordance with Article 15a of the Federal Constitutional Law, was reached to ensure for the formulation of common goals and to provide for the coordination of future action. This agreement on energy efficiency entered into force on 15 June 1995. According to the objectives stated in the 1993 Energy Report, the following measures were adopted in the agreement: - Harmonisation of federal and provincial regulations for the realisation of the agreements objectives. - Basic regulations regarding the energy consumption of appliances. - Specific regulations regarding heating systems and building structures. - Increased consideration of objectives relating to environmental policies.
